Job Responsibility Summary:
Serve as a supportive liaison between students, homes, school, family services, protective services, doctors or other contacts to assist with student issues such as disabilities, substance abuse and rehabilitation, mental or physical abuse, mental health, poverty, misbehavior, absenteeism, and other related needs.
Counsel and educate students, families, community groups, faculty, and staff members on topics listed above.
Provide or arrange medical and psychiatric testing and additional supportive services for students and families related to topics listed above.
Comply with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A) and current educational privacy regulations to ensure student confidentiality.
Collect supplementary information to assist students and families such as employment records, medical records, school reports, or other records as needed.
Assist with crisis intervention.
Maintain student case history records as required by laws, district policies, and administrative regulations.
Conduct research and prepare reports as requested by administration.
Other duties as assigned.
